| M Formula: | Cs2CO3 |
| Properties: | |
| White, hygroscopic, crystalline powder. Very stable. Can be heated to high temperature without loss of CO2. Soluble in water, alcohol, and ether. | |
| Derivation: | |
| By passing carbon dioxide into a solution of cesium hydroxide and subsequent crystallization. | |
| Use: | |
| Brewing, mineral waters, ingredient of specialty glasses, polymerization catalyst for ethylene oxide. | |
